Skip to Content

Lumene Nordic Hydra Birch Dew Jelly Dual Hydrating Serum Face Moisturizer With Hyaluronic Acid And Nordic Birch Sap 1.7 Fl Oz

Barcode: 6412600858792
Price
1.00 1.00